Women panel holds awareness programme on gender based violence

FROM A CORRESPONDENT

SHILLONG, Nov 28: The Meghalaya State Commission for Women in collaboration with the Department of Social Work, Martin Luther Christian University, is observing the 16 days of Activism Against Gender Based Violence with a series of events throughout the Khasi/Jaintia Hills in an effort to create mass awareness about the different threats faced by people because of gender based mindset.

The first event in this awareness programme was the street play performed by the students of BSW third Semester at the Smit Market area today. The programme started with a short speech by the Vice Chairperson of the Meghalaya State Commission for Women, Gamchi Marak, where she spoke about the threats faced by women in society today.
